Damages & Insurance Settlement

The fire caused substantial damage to the church building, but the damage was not as serious as initially thought. The center portion of the church sustained the greatest damage, but a subsequent assessment of the building determined that much of the building could be saved.

Additional details: On the day of the fire, witnesses considered the church to be a complete loss, and the next day, the Courant headline declared that the “fire completely destroys” the church.

The church apparently held two insurance policies, one for the building and one for the fixtures. Initially, it was not believed that the insurance would cover the full cost to rebuild the church, but ultimately it was anticipated that the settlement would cover most of that cost.
